M-22: A Lake Michigan Lover's Dream


If there's one drive that captures the essence of Michigan's beauty, it's M-22. This route winds along the Lake Michigan coastline and with the Sleeping Bear Dunes National Lakeshore. The sights are motion picture-- towering dunes, stretching vineyards, quaint harbor communities, and sparkling blue water that seems to take place forever.


You could find yourself pulling over commonly, not due to a tire repair service emergency situation, however because you merely can not resist breaking an image or getting hold of a cherry pie from a roadside stand. From Manistee to Traverse City, every stop is a prize, and every mile feels like a postcard.


The Tunnel of Trees: A Canopy of Natural Wonder


The Tunnel of Trees, officially called M-119, is more than simply a drive-- it's an experience. Leaving Lake Michigan's northeastern edge from Harbor Springs to Cross Village, this slim road is wrapped up in a dense cover of hardwood trees that rupture right into flaming reds, oranges, and yellows each autumn.

US-2 Across the Upper Peninsula: Untamed and Unforgettable


Cross the legendary Mackinac Bridge and you'll find yourself in Michigan's wilder side-- the Upper Peninsula. US-2 takes you western along the Lake Michigan coastline, where the sights really feel unblemished and raw. Pine woodlands stretch for miles, freshwater beaches glimmer in the sunlight, and roadside pull-offs disclose private gems.


It's an excellent path for those who delight in the journey as much as the location. The Copper Country Trail: History Meets Rugged Beauty


For something genuinely off the beaten track, the Copper Country Trail in the Keweenaw Peninsula supplies a mix of all-natural charm and rich heritage. This stretch winds via old mining towns, thick forests, and cliffside lookouts that supply sweeping views of Lake Superior.

Bluewater Highway: The Coastal Route Through Eastern Michigan


On the east side of the state, the Bluewater Highway (M-25) traces the curve of Lake Huron. Beginning near Port Huron and traveling north to Bay City, this drive showcases lighthouses, coastal communities, and endless views of freshwater waves.
